About Hala A. Salah

Hala A. Salah is a scholar working on Biotechnology, Biochemistry and Parasitology, having authored 24 papers that have together received 456 indexed citations. Recurring topics across this work include Enzyme Production and Characterization (7 papers), Enzyme Catalysis and Immobilization (5 papers) and Phytochemicals and Antioxidant Activities (4 papers). The work is most often cited by research in Biotechnology (90 citations), Biochemistry (51 citations) and Food Science (84 citations). Hala A. Salah has collaborated with scholars based in Egypt, Saudi Arabia and China. Frequent co-authors include Saleh A. Mohamed, Azza M. Abdel‐Aty, Afaf S. Fahmy, Roqaya I. Bassuiny, Heidi M. Abdel-Mageed, Tarek M. Mohamed, Ahmed S. I. Aly, Ahmed Tawfik, Fangang Meng and Zhong Yu.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and Scientific Reports.
